1. What is the primary purpose of a wastewater collection system?
A) To treat industrial toxic waste down to drinking water standards
B) To safely collect and convey wastewater to a treatment facility
C) To store stormwater for long-term agricultural irrigation use
D) To separate oil and grease at the commercial source completely
Correct Answer: B
Rationale: The foundational purpose of any wastewater
collection system is to gather municipal sewage and transport it
efficiently and safely to a treatment plant while protecting public
health and preventing environmental contamination.
2. Which of the following parameters represents a typical minimum
scouring velocity required in a gravity sanitary sewer line to
prevent solids from settling?
A) 0.5 feet per second (fps)
B) 1.0 feet per second (fps)
C) 2.0 feet per second (fps)
D) 5.0 feet per second (fps)
Correct Answer: C
Rationale: Industry standards and regulatory guidelines
generally establish a minimum velocity of 2.0 feet per second
(fps) for gravity sewer designs. This scouring velocity is critical to
ensure that suspended organic and inorganic solids remain in
motion and do not deposit on the pipe invert.

,3. While performing routine maintenance, a collection system
operator notices a strong odor of rotten eggs coming from a
manhole. This gas is most likely:
A) Carbon monoxide (CO)
B) Hydrogen sulfide (H2S)
C) Methane (CH4)
D) Sulfur dioxide (SO2)
Correct Answer: B
Rationale: Hydrogen sulfide gas (H2S) is generated by the
anaerobic decomposition of sulfur compounds in stagnant
wastewater. It is easily recognized in low concentrations by its
characteristic "rotten egg" smell and poses severe toxic, explosive,
and corrosive hazards.
4. Which atmospheric hazard in a confined space is classified as an
asymptomatic asphyxiant and is highly flammable, lighter than air,
but lacks any natural odor?
A) Hydrogen sulfide
B) Methane
C) Carbon dioxide
D) Nitrogen dioxide
Correct Answer: B
Rationale: Methane (CH4) is a byproduct of anaerobic
decomposition in collection networks. It is a colorless, odorless,
highly flammable gas that can displace oxygen in enclosed
spaces, leading to physical asphyxiation.
5. According to OSHA standards, what is the minimum permissible
oxygen concentration required for safe entry into a permit-
required confined space without supplied-air respirators?
A) 16.0%
B) 19.5%
C) 21.0%
D) 23.5%
Correct Answer: B
Rationale: OSHA defines an oxygen-deficient atmosphere as
any environment containing less than 19.5% oxygen by volume.
Safe oxygen levels for entries must range between 19.5% and
23.5%.

,6. What is the main structural function of a drop manhole
configuration in a gravity sewer system?
A) To increase the overall flow velocity of upstream sewer
segments
B) To prevent the excessive erosion of the manhole invert due to
vertical drops
C) To allow maintenance personnel a safer entry route into deep
trench lines
D) To trap heavy silts and gravel before they enter down-gradient
trunk lines
Correct Answer: B
Rationale: Drop manholes are constructed when an incoming
sewer pipe enters more than 24 inches above the outgoing invert.
The internal or external drop stack directs flow smoothly to the
bottom, mitigating structural erosion, turbulence, and the release
of toxic H2S gas.
7. Which pipeline cleaning method relies on high-velocity water jets
to dislodge roots, emulsify grease, and flush debris down the line?
A) Power rodding
B) Hydro-jetting (high-velocity cleaner)
C) Sewer balling
D) Bucket machine dragging
Correct Answer: B
Rationale: Hydro-jetters use high-pressure pumps to force
water through a specialized nozzle. The forward-facing jets break
up obstructions while rear-facing jets propel the hose forward
and drag loose debris back toward the manhole for removal.
8. An operator needs to locate a buried metallic pipe using an
electronic pipe locator. This instrument operates primarily on what
physical principle?
A) Acoustic wave attenuation
B) Electromagnetic induction
C) Hydrostatic pressure reflection
D) Gamma-ray backscattering
Correct Answer: B
Rationale: Electronic pipe locators use an electromagnetic
transmitter to apply a signal to the metallic utility line, which is

, then tracked above-ground using a receiver tuned to that specific
frequency.
9. What type of pump is most commonly utilized in small wastewater
lift stations because it can handle significant solids without
clogging?
A) Multistage centrifugal turbine pump
B) Submersible non-clog centrifugal pump
C) Rotary gear positive displacement pump
D) Axial-flow propeller pump
Correct Answer: B
Rationale: Submersible non-clog centrifugal pumps feature
specially designed open or recessed impellers with wide clear
passages. This allows them to pass large solids, rags, and stringy
materials common in domestic sewage.
10. What does the term "Infiltration" specifically refer to in a
collection network?
A) Stormwater entering the system directly through holes in
manhole covers
B) Groundwater entering the sewer system through cracked pipes,
joints, and root intrusions
C) Industrial wastewater discharges that exceed localized volume
permissions
D) Rainwater entering via illegal residential roof downspout
connections
Correct Answer: B
Rationale: Infiltration is defined as groundwater that enters
the collection network through structural defects below the water
table, such as fractured pipes, faulty joints, or damaged manhole
walls. Entry through surface openings is classified as Inflow.
